Lemon Shrimp Pasta

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 15 minutes
Total Time 30 minutes
This Lemon Shrimp Pasta combines tender shrimp, garlic, Parmesan cheese, and a creamy lemon sauce with al dente pasta for a delightful, zesty meal perfect for both casual dinners and elegant occasions.
4 Servings

Ingredients

  • Pasta: 12 ounces spaghetti or any long, thin pasta noodles
  • Olive Oil: 2 tablespoons
  • Shrimp: 1 pound large shrimp peeled and deveined
  • Salt and Black Pepper: To taste
  • Garlic: 4 cloves minced
  • Red Pepper Flakes Optional: 1/4 teaspoon
  • Lemon Zest: From 1 lemon
  • Lemon Juice: From 2 lemons
  • Chicken or Vegetable Broth: 1 cup
  • Heavy Cream: 1/4 cup
  • Parmesan Cheese: 1/2 cup grated
  • Fresh Parsley: 2 tablespoons chopped
  • Lemon Slices and Parmesan Cheese: For garnish

Instructions
 

Prepare the Pasta:

  1. Bring a large pot of well-salted water to a boil. Cook the spaghetti according to package instructions until it reaches an al dente texture. Reserve approximately 1 cup of the pasta water before draining. Drain the pasta and set it aside.

Cook the Shrimp:

  1. Pat the shrimp dry using paper towels to remove excess moisture. Season both sides with salt and pepper. In a large skillet, heat olive oil over medium-high heat. Add the shrimp and cook for approximately 2 minutes per side, until they become pink and firm. Remove the shrimp from the skillet and set aside.

Prepare the Sauce:

  1. Reduce the skillet's heat to medium-low. Add minced garlic and red pepper flakes (if using) to the skillet and sauté for approximately 1 minute until fragrant. Stir in the lemon zest, lemon juice, and broth. Allow the mixture to simmer and reduce slightly for approximately 2 minutes.

Incorporate the Cream and Cheese:

  1. Gradually add the heavy cream to the skillet, stirring continuously until thoroughly combined. Slowly incorporate the Parmesan cheese in small increments, ensuring it melts smoothly into the sauce. If the sauce appears too thick, gradually add reserved pasta water until it reaches the desired consistency.

Combine Pasta and Shrimp:

  1. Return the cooked pasta and shrimp to the skillet. Toss all components together until the pasta is evenly coated with the sauce. Taste the dish and adjust seasoning with additional salt and pepper, if necessary.

Serve and Garnish:

  1. Transfer the prepared pasta to serving plates. Garnish with chopped parsley, additional Parmesan cheese, and lemon slices as desired. Serve promptly and enjoy.

Notes

To make this Lemon Shrimp Pasta gluten-free, substitute the regular pasta with your preferred gluten-free pasta variety. Ensure the broth and Parmesan cheese are certified gluten-free for maximum safety.
